Before you buy

  • Confirm the UPC box: a publisher mark instead of a barcode means direct edition, a barcode means newsstand.
  • Glossy covers of this era show edge chipping easily. Check black edges closely in the photos.
  • Check the staples and centerfold; heavily read anniversary and key issues loosen there first.
